ZOM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

28 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zomedica Corp. (ZOM)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$3.26M — down 41% from $5.55M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 15 funds closed out of ZOM and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 7 trimmed existing stakes and 10 added.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$122K. The largest seller was BlackRock, exiting entirely with an estimated $610K sold.
